Deputy Prime Minister for Reintegration on working visit to Romanian-language educational institutions in Tiraspol and Bender

During his visit to the Transnistrian region on 26 February, Deputy Prime Minister for Reintegration Valeriu Chiveri paid a working visit to Lucian Blaga Theoretical Lyceum in Tiraspol and Alexandru cel Bun Theoretical Lyceum in Bender. During the meetings, the Deputy Prime Minister met with the management of the institutions and teaching staff.

The discussions focused on the main challenges faced by Romanian-language educational institutions in the region, identifying solutions to overcome existing difficulties, as well as on support measures that can be provided by the authorities of the Republic of Moldova.

One of the most pressing issues concerns the lack of their own premises that would ensure adequate conditions for the conduct of the educational process. The situation is all the more sensitive as in the respective localities there are buildings that could be adapted to the needs of these institutions, in the context of the constant increase in the number of applications for enrollment.

At the same time, the administrations emphasized the need to ensure real continuity between cycles of study at all educational levels, including through the deepening and diversification of educational offerings.

A particularly serious issue remains the illegal and forced conscription of young people into unconstitutional military structures, a practice that generates major obstacles for students and directly affects their educational and personal path.

The official reiterated the commitment of the authorities of the Republic of Moldova to continue supporting the right to education in the Romanian language and the uninterrupted functioning of educational institutions in the region, despite the existing difficulties.
